Has anyone had trouble upgrading RAM on the ASUS P2B-F motherboard. Spec
sheets on their site says it's capable of supporting a gig of RAM, but
when I do so, the kernel can't boot up. It starts and reboots over and
over.

It has four slots and I'm using 256 meg chips. Dropping back to 768m
works, but I'd really like to use the full gig capacity.

Any ideas?
